1. The Strategic Imperative of AI Visibility for C-Suite Executives

Understanding AI Visibility in the Enterprise Context

AI visibility refers to the comprehensive insight executives and teams have into how AI systems operate, make decisions, and impact business outcomes. For the C-suite, this visibility enables direct oversight of predictive models, customer engagement algorithms, and automation pipelines.

Without this transparency, leadership is exposed to unknown risks and missed revenue opportunities. With clarity into AI operations, executives can align AI deployment tightly with overarching business strategy and customer experience goals.

Linking AI Visibility to Corporate Performance

Visibility acts as a bridge between AI capabilities and measurable performance metrics like conversion rates, customer lifetime value, and operational efficiency. Leaders who embed AI visibility into their C-suite strategy can swiftly identify bottlenecks, biases, or inefficiencies affecting customer interaction.

For instance, execs can track how AI-driven personalization engines perform across segments, allowing for real-time adjustments to campaigns or services, which directly influences revenue growth.

2. Enhancing Customer Interaction Through AI Visibility

Mapping AI’s Impact on the Customer Journey

Customer interaction increasingly integrates AI-driven touchpoints: chatbots, recommendation engines, dynamic pricing, and predictive service. AI visibility allows leaders to monitor these touchpoints holistically, identifying scenarios where AI may increase friction or cause disengagement.

For example, by analyzing AI’s role in chatbot responses, the C-suite can detect patterns leading to poor customer satisfaction and take corrective action swiftly.

Data-Driven Personalization with Transparency

Accurate personalization depends on clear insight into data flow and model behavior. Executives empowered with AI visibility can ensure personal data is used ethically and effectively, boosting customer trust and long-term engagement.

4. The Role of Data Governance in AI Visibility

Establishing Governance Frameworks for AI Transparency

Robust data governance underpins AI visibility by setting standards for data accuracy, lineage, and ethical use. The C-suite should champion governance protocols to ensure AI decisions are auditable and compliant.

Balancing Compliance with Innovation

Regulations such as GDPR and CCPA mandate transparent data practices. AI visibility helps navigate these requirements while still enabling innovation via iterative AI development and deployment.

Tools and Techniques for Operational Data Oversight

Governance tools that provide audit trails, real-time monitoring, and model explainability are key to maintaining AI visibility. Leaders should invest in platforms that deliver dashboards tailored for executive stakeholders.

6. AI Visibility Tools: Features to Prioritize

Real-Time Monitoring and Alerts

A robust AI visibility solution offers instant insights into performance degradation or data drift, triggering automated alerts to leaders before issues escalate.

Explainability and Interpretability Modules

Transparency into model reasoning allows the C-suite to understand AI decision pathways, fostering trust and regulatory compliance.

Integrated KPI Dashboards

Single-pane-of-glass dashboards combining AI metrics with business KPIs empower holistic views necessary for strategic adjustments.

8. Implementing AI Visibility: Step-by-Step for the C-Suite

Step 1: Audit Current AI and Data Landscape

Map existing AI assets, data sources, and business processes to identify visibility gaps. Use tools like dashboards and logs to baseline.

Step 2: Define Executive Visibility Requirements

Specify clear KPIs and compliance metrics the C-suite requires for oversight to ensure alignment with digital transformation goals.

Step 3: Deploy Visibility Solutions and Train Teams

Choose tools to provide real-time monitoring and explainability. Support staff and executives with training on interpreting insights and taking action.

Step 4: Establish Governance and Continuous Improvement

Integrate AI visibility into governance frameworks to ensure ongoing transparency and adaptation to evolving risks.

9. Overcoming Challenges to AI Visibility in Large Enterprises

Data Silos and Fragmented Systems

Enterprises often struggle with disjointed data and AI applications, limiting visibility. Strategies include centralized data lakes and unified AI management platforms.

Cross-Functional Communication Barriers

The C-suite must foster a culture bridging technical and business units for shared understanding of AI insights and implications.

Scalability and Performance Constraints

Visibility tools must scale with data volumes and query complexity. Cloud-based solutions enable elastic scaling and real-time responsiveness.
